Twenty social entrepreneurs are part of the fourth Social Innovators Program & Awards (SIPA) in Lagos.

Backed by LEAP Africa and Union Bank of Nigeria, the program incubates 20 social entrepreneurs focused on critical issues, like malnutrition, which affects 20 percent of Nigeria’s children.

Now in its fourth year, SIPA has additional impact as well, creating employment opportunities for young people, 45 percent of whom are jobless.
